Product Details
- 2009 compilation from the Easy Listening crooner, a collection of his best loved hits from throughout his expansive career. Roger Whittaker emerged into the music scene in the mid '60's. Seen to many as a late successor to Bing Cosby, Whittaker's relaxed style has led to over 40 million sales worldwide. Roger Whittaker's success grew throughout the 70's, racking up a string of Top 20 hits on both sides of the Atlantic. His popularity over the years has still not waned. Features 22 tracks including 'Steel Men', 'The Last Farewell', 'Durham Town', 'If I Were a Rich Man' and many more. Universal.
